Madhappy is a Los Angeles-based clothing brand made for a community of optimists, born in 2017. Madhappy uses apparel, events, and experimental retail spaces – including its permanent flagship in West Hollywood – to explore a personal expression as a means to an improved state of mind. Its own seasonal stores – with past and present locations including New York City (Soho), Aspen, Miami, East Hampton, and Tokyo – are each designed to reflect their site, while still sharing the brand’s DNA. The brand currently produces a selection of ever-evolving, evergreen classic styles, seasonally available collections and collaborations. Madhappy supports research and awareness in mental health through The Madhappy Foundation (a 501c(3) non-profit) and writes Local Optimist, a print magazine. About the job

We are looking to hire a full-time Technical Design Manager on our Product Development & Production team. 


In this position, you will be responsible for fit, grading, garment construction across a wide range of domestic and overseas garment dye knits/wovens/sweaters and outerwear categories. This role will report directly to our VP of Product Development & Production.


You must be based in or willing to move to Los Angeles to be considered for this position.


Responsibilities

●      Product measurement specification:

 ●      Ovesee the Technical Department by leading all seasonal fittings 

 ●      Provide mentorship to Technical team 

 ●      Collaborating with Design and PD on tech pack hand-offs to help identify reference silhouette and/or fit block for each model and troubleshoot construction details suitable for development

 ●      Support Design team in initial build of Technical Packages

 ●      Create POMs, construction and hand off comments for all programs and coordinate with PD for release with relevant direction, samples and reference garments

 ●      Review and analyze blocks/core fits for consistency

●      Fit approvals:

 ●      Ensure all fit garments and evaluation sheets have been received from factories and measure /evaluate prior to fitting from initial Development through Production

 ●      Schedule and lead live fittings

 ●      Management of fit approval process/comments in accordance with Protos,  Samples, Bulk Fit/PPS, and TOP deadlines

 ●      Maintain consistent and accurate fit comments, grade rules, and tolerances and supply POM sketches and detail grading as appropriate for category at stock approval

 ●      Create diagrams/sketches and pattern corrections as needed to support revisions visually

●      Systems:

 ●      Specification details - create + edit measurement pages and all related pages alongside the other product functions

 ●      Maintain information on Excel/Chart System and share drive with all updates, graded specifications, fit photos, fit notes, technical diagrams, and written comments

 ●      Maintain digital and physical style reference libraries by category
